Editors comment:
Multipoker is a skin to Party Poker, the largest site in the world. 50,000+ players are here on peak hours. They don’t share the multi table tournaments with Party Poker and has therefore much less traffic at the tournaments. Multipoker is a popular room for European players because of the direct withdrawal to bank account feature.
Full review:
(This casino has decided not to allow US players at the moment) The software runs smooth and quick but doesn’t have the best graphics out there. The Party Poker network has the largest player volume in the world. At peak hours there are 16000-18000 cash game players and 20000-25000 tournament players but since Multipoker doesn’t share tournament traffic with Party Poker do they not have the same tournament volume.
Cash game variation is very good with the most popular game being fixed limit Texas Hold’em. But there are many tables open in the other games as well. The other games they offer are Omaha both high and high-low versions and Seven-Card Stud, both high and high-low. Multipoker doesn’t have a loyalty program like frequent player points but they host some free-rolls for players that have played raked hands. The rake is standard except the low limit games which is very unattractive for the players. On the $0.5-$1 and $1-$2 tables Multipoker take 10% rake on $5 pots ($0.5 on a $5 pot).
